Seal developer and manufacturer Busak+Shamban is a strategic sealing partner to Bluewater who design, develop, manage, construct and operate Floating Production Storage Offloading (FPSO) vessels.

These extract and process crude oil in deep water offshore and are an alternative to a fixed rig.

There are hundreds of seals fitted on turret mooring systems, the integral component of the FPSO.

Its product transfer system contains risers, flexible hoses that connect the subsea piping to the FPSO and a swivel stack linking it to the FPSO piping.

The swivel stack provides multiple fluid paths for transfer of gas, water and crude oil.

In addition, to the swivel stack a utility swivel is used for hydraulics, chemical injection and an electrical/ instrumentation slip-ring.

The seal within the slip-ring assembly is of a large diameter, in excess of two metres.

An operator required one of these replaced during maintenance and faced the possibility of considerable downtime and therefore loss of income.

Exchanging the seal meant complete dismantling of the swivel stack and possible shipment back to land for installation.

This was further complicated by it being mid-winter, with the FPSO located at a considerable distance off the Norwegian coast.

Working together, Busak+Shamban and Bluewater developed a unique innovative solution to replace the seal with the minimum of disruption to the process.

A seal was designed to the required dimensions but instead of being in one piece it was split.

The original seal was removed without dismantling the swivel stack.

The split seal was then fitted in its place, glued and pinned.

This required only a few hours of down time instead of several weeks.
